Сообщение об ошибке сообщает о неожиданном do, потому что вы использовали его неправильно: do - это зарезервированное слово, используемое в циклах for, case, while и until. Поскольку предыдущий комментарий заканчивается на for i in $*, я предполагаю, что вы просто забыли добавить разрыв строки там:
# now calculate the average of the numbers given on command line as cmd args
for i in $*
do
# addition of all the numbers on cmd args
temp_total='expr $temp_total + $1 '
done
man bash / SHELL GRAMMAR / Compound Commands объясняет, как построить for и другие циклы , Если вы просто хотите перебрать все аргументы bash, также поддерживает короткую форму, я буду комбинировать ее с bash Арифметическим расширением здесь:
# now calculate the average of the numbers given on command line as cmd args
for i
do
# addition of all the numbers on cmd args
temp_total=$((temp_total+i))
done
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 от vi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Сохраните файл viber.deb в папке Откройте папку в терминале, выполните следующие команды: dpkg-deb -x viber.deb viber dpkg-deb - -control viber.deb viber / DEBIAN Редактировать viber / DEBIAN / control и repace «libcurl3» с «libcurl4» (также удалить последнюю пустую строку из файла или вы получите сообщение об ошибке) dpkg -b viber viberlibcurl4.deb sudo dpkg -i viberlibcurl4.deb Или установите файл .deb с помощью gdebiViber, похоже, работ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ии. ..
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ic-beaver-linux
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 от vi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Сохраните файл viber.deb в папке Откройте папку в терминале, выполните следующие команды: dpkg-deb -x viber.deb viber dpkg-deb - -control viber.deb viber / DEBIAN Редактировать viber / DEBIAN / control и repace «libcurl3» с «libcurl4» (также удалить последнюю пустую строку из файла или вы получите сообщение об ошибке) dpkg -b viber viberlibcurl4.deb sudo dpkg -i viberlibcurl4.deb Или установите файл .deb с помощью gdebiViber, похоже, работ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ии. ..
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ic-beaver-linux
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 от vi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Сохраните файл viber.deb в папке Откройте папку в терминале, выполните следующие команды: dpkg-deb -x viber.deb viber dpkg-deb - -control viber.deb viber / DEBIAN Редактировать viber / DEBIAN / control и repace «libcurl3» с «libcurl4» (также удалить последнюю пустую строку из файла или вы получите сообщение об ошибке) dpkg -b viber viberlibcurl4.deb sudo dpkg -i viberlibcurl4.deb Или установите файл .deb с помощью gdebiViber, похоже, работ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ии. ..
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ic-beaver-linux
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 для vi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Теперь Viber работ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ic -beaver-линукс
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 для vi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Теперь Viber работ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ic -beaver-линукс
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 для vi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Теперь Viber работ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ic -beaver-линукс
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 для vi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Теперь Viber работ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ic -beaver-линукс
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 для vi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Теперь Viber работ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ic -beaver-линукс
Проблема связана не только с файлом viber.deb, но также с требованием libcurl3 для viber.deb.
В 18.04 libcurl3 не может сосуществовать с libcurl4, поэтому вы столкнетесь с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для депакинга, исправьте зависимость и затем создайте новый файл viber.
Шаги:
Теперь Viber работает нормально с libcurl4 aleast для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https://lin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ic -beaver-линукс
Лучший способ установить отдельные deb-пакеты для использования APT-инструмента, который автоматически разрешит все зависимости:
sudo apt-get install ./Downloads/viber.deb
Проблема связана не только с файлом viber.deb
, но также с требованием libcurl3
к viber.deb
.
В Ubuntu 18.04 libcurl3
не может сосуществовать с libcurl4
, поэтому вы идете сталкиваться с проблемами с другими приложениями. В моем случае Viber and Steam не могли сосуществовать.
После некоторого поиска я нашел следующее решение для deb-пакета, исправьте зависимость и затем создайте новый файл viber.
Шаги:
viber.deb
в папке dpkg-deb -x viber.deb viber
dpkg-deb --control viber.deb viber/DEBIAN
viber/DEBIAN/control
и замените "libcurl3" на "libcurl4" (также удалите последний пробел из файла или вы получите сообщение об ошибке) dpkg -b viber viberlibcurl4.deb
sudo dpkg -i viberlibcurl4.deb
или установите файл .deb
с помощью gdebi
Вибер, кажется, работает нормально с libcurl4
по крайней мере для меня до сих пор.
Я нашел решение здесь, в комментарии ...
https: //linuxconfig.org/how-to-install-viber-on-ubuntu-18-04-bionic-beaver-linux
Самый простой способ - конвертировать пакет rpm на веб-сайт Viber в пакет deb. Для этого:
Загрузите пакет rpm с помощью:
wget https://download.cdn.viber.com/desktop/Linux/viber.rpm
Установите чужой, конвертируйте пакет rpm и установите вновь созданный пакет deb:
sudo apt-get install alien
sudo alien --to-deb --scripts viber.rpm
sudo dpkg -i viber_7.0.0.1035-3_amd64.deb
3] Преобразование займет около 5 минут. Будьте терпеливы! Решение об установке Viber on Ubuntu 18.04 заключается в том, чтобы явно включить предварительное условие пакета libcurl3 как часть команды установки apt:
sudo apt install libcurl3 ~/Downloads/viber.deb
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ux [ ! d1]
Вы также можете просто установить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ux из flathub.org
Вы можете попытаться исправить сломанные зависимости следующей командой:
sudo apt-get install -f
После этого попробуйте еще раз установить Viber с помощью команды:
sudo dpkg -i Downloads/viber.deb
Лучший способ установить отдельные deb-пакеты для использования APT-инструмента, который автоматически разрешит все зависимости:
sudo apt-get install ./Downloads/viber.deb
Вы можете попытаться исправить сломанные зависимости следующей командой:
sudo apt-get install -f
После этого попробуйте еще раз установить Viber с помощью команды:
sudo dpkg -i Downloads/viber.deb
Самый простой способ - конвертировать пакет rpm на веб-сайт Viber в пакет deb. Для этого:
Загрузите пакет rpm с помощью:
wget https://download.cdn.viber.com/desktop/Linux/viber.rpm
Установите чужой, конвертируйте пакет rpm и установите вновь созданный пакет deb:
sudo apt-get install alien
sudo alien --to-deb --scripts viber.rpm
sudo dpkg -i viber_7.0.0.1035-3_amd64.deb
Преобразование займет около 5 минут. Будьте терпеливы!
Решение об установке Viber on Ubuntu 18.04 заключается в том, чтобы явно включить предварительное условие пакета libcurl3 как часть команды установки apt:
sudo apt install libcurl3 ~/Downloads/viber.deb
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ux [ ! d1]
Вы также можете просто установить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ux из flathub.org
Лучший способ установить отдельные deb-пакеты для использования APT-инструмента, который автоматически разрешит все зависимости:
sudo apt-get install ./Downloads/viber.deb
sudo dpkg -i --ignore-depends=libcurl3 viber.deb
Отлично работает для меня.
Вы можете попытаться исправить сломанные зависимости следующей командой:
sudo apt-get install -f
После этого попробуйте еще раз установить Viber с помощью команды:
sudo dpkg -i Downloads/viber.deb
Самый простой способ - конвертировать пакет rpm на веб-сайт Viber в пакет deb. Для этого:
Загрузите пакет rpm с помощью:
wget https://download.cdn.viber.com/desktop/Linux/viber.rpm
Установите чужой, конвертируйте пакет rpm и установите вновь созданный пакет deb:
sudo apt-get install alien
sudo alien --to-deb --scripts viber.rpm
sudo dpkg -i viber_7.0.0.1035-3_amd64.deb
Преобразование займет около 5 минут. Будьте терпеливы!
Решение об установке Viber on Ubuntu 18.04 заключается в том, чтобы явно включить предварительное условие пакета libcurl3 как часть команды установки apt:
sudo apt install libcurl3 ~/Downloads/viber.deb
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ux [ ! d1]
Вы также можете просто установить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ux из flathub.org
Лучший способ установить отдельные deb-пакеты для использования APT-инструмента, который автоматически разрешит все зависимости:
sudo apt-get install ./Downloads/viber.deb
sudo dpkg -i --ignore-depends=libcurl3 viber.deb
Отлично работает для меня.
Вы можете попытаться исправить разбитые зависимости с помощью следующей команды:
sudo apt-get install -f
После этого попробуйте еще раз установить Viber с помощью команды, которую вы использовали:
sudo dpkg -i Downloads/viber.deb
Самый простой способ - конвертировать пакет rpm на веб-сайт Viber в пакет deb. Для этого:
Загрузите пакет rpm с помощью:
wget https://download.cdn.viber.com/desktop/Linux/viber.rpm
Установите чужой, конвертируйте пакет rpm и установите вновь созданный пакет deb:
sudo apt-get install alien
sudo alien --to-deb --scripts viber.rpm
sudo dpkg -i viber_7.0.0.1035-3_amd64.deb
Преобразование займет около 5 минут. Будьте терпеливы!
Решение об установке Viber on Ubuntu 18.04 заключается в том, чтобы явно включить предварительное условие пакета libcurl3
как часть команды установки apt:
sudo apt install libcurl3 ~/Downloads/viber.deb
Как установить Viber на Ubuntu 18.04 Bionic Beaver Linux
Вы также можете просто установить версию flatpak с flathub.org
Лучший способ установить отдельные deb-пакеты для использования APT-инструмента, который автоматически разрешит все зависимости:
sudo apt-get install ./Downloads/viber.deb
sudo dpkg -i --ignore-depends=libcurl3 viber.deb
Отлично работает для меня.